REMINDER/Major New Green Building Project in Montreal: Proment Seeking Quebec's First Residential High-Rise LEED Certification
MONTREAL, QUEBEC--(CCNMatthews - Sept. 19, 2006) - Proment Corporation, a leader in Quebec's residential housing industry, will unveil details of a major new development planned for the southern tip of Ile-des-Soeurs. The press conference will provide an overview of the new venture, including changes and standards needed to obtain the first L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) Certification, a first in Quebec for this type of high-rise housing project.

About Proment Corporation
Founded in 1965, Proment Corporation (proment.com) is a real estate developer known for innovative residential projects such as Les Sommets sur le fleuve, Le Domaine de la Pointe, Les Verrieres sur le fleuve, Le Cours du fleuve, Val de l'Anse, Le Club Marin and Domaine de la Foret - all of which are located on Ile-des-Soeurs. Proment's innovative design and quality construction have been honored on numerous occasions by the APCHQ (the Quebec homebuilders association), the Quebec Order of Architects and Sauvons Montreal. Proment has been named "Builder of the Year" four times in the past 20 years alone.
